  •  Responsibilities

    Assist with the planning of classroom activities and instruction. Assist in the monitoring of students in all classroom situations: large group, small group, centers, naptime. Assist in the assessment of the development skills of students. Assist with the instruction of children in large and small groups and on an individual basis; Assist with the development of teacher-made activities and materials for units of instruction. Assist with the maintenance of accurate pupil accounting records in compliance with local and state requirements. Assist with the management of the classroom according to the rules and regulations developed for the school and for the classroom specifically. Help with the special needs of the students (toileting, physical therapy for the handicapped, feeding) as needed. Assist with the preparation of materials for classroom activities and learning centers and daily maintenance and clean up of the classroom environment. Perform such other tasks as may be assigned.

  •  Experience/Qualifications

    High school diploma or equivalent. Minimum of 60 hours college credit or passing score on paraprofessional test; 2 year degree preferred. Must have ability to prioritize tasks and work independently. Must be able to handle, in a calm, intelligent manner, any unexpected situation that may occur. Must have good communication and interpersonal skills. Must have ability to work with minimum supervision. Must have ability to work with minimal supervision. Must have computer skills using Windows-based programs.
